Here’s Your Guide to Understanding Indonesian Visa for Indians This Year On December 15, 2021 By Armand Levitz Indonesia is one of Asia’s most beautiful countries. On a […] Share this:FacebookTumblrTwitterLinkedInEmailPinterestRedditPocketPrintTelegramWhatsAppLike this:Like Loading...